Its name comes from the palaeozoic marble from which it was formed.
The numerous stalactites and stalagmites are remarkably beautiful and marble cave also has an underground lake.
While the cave is not very large it has everything you expect to see in a cave.
The cave was discovered in 1966 by a citizen building his house and it was opened for tourists in 1976.
The cave is 1260 meters long while the tourist path is around 500 meters long.
